For this reason, the first room you should redecorate to ensure your home is welcoming is the living room.  This is often the first room people see when they enter your home and will set the tone for the rest of the house. When you are spending time and effort on redecorating your new home, you want it to look gorgeous by the end of the project.

Begin with the Center Piece. The rest of the room revolves around it. In the bedroom, this piece is usually the bed. In the living room, it can be an expensive couch, a grand painting, or even a center table. This makes it easier to redecorate the room according to your tastes and organizes the work. Try adding new colors. One of the cheapest and easiest ways to transform your home is by giving it a fresh coat of paint. To maximize the impact, you should stop playing safe and go with a bold, rich, and vibrant shade. You don’t need to select one color and just run with it; you should choose contrasting colors since that looks more cohesive than a single color. By adding color to your pillows, walls, and any other décor you may be using. The new colors need to complement each other. To create a nice flow. Accent pillows come in a lot of different patterns and colors that you can use in combination with an accent wall to make it stand out. Decorating your home will take some time, so there is no need to rush. As you see your home changing you will get new ideas on how to decorate it. There is no rush to get it all done as soon as possible. Here are some elements that you can focus on as you start planning and shaping your home:

-Accent Colors

-Flooring

-Carpets/Rugs

-Storage/Organization

-Accent Furniture

-Lighting

-Pillows and Throws

-Wall Art

-Window Treatments
